Premier Jay Weatherill has today made the extraordinary claim that Federal Labor Leader Bill Shorten is “not relevant” and cannot make a difference.
The shock statement was made just hours before Mr Shorten is expected to deliver his budget response.
Premier Weatherill made the claim on ABC Radio this morning:
“He’s not relevant. He can’t make a difference.”
“It’s both scary and informative that Premier Weatherill thinks that the Federal leader of his party is irrelevant and can’t make a difference,” said Shadow Treasurer Rob Lucas.
“Mr Weatherill has been embarrassed by Mr Shorten’s refusal to commit to providing an extra $80 billion in health and education funding to the states.
“It is absolutely hypocritical of Mr Weatherill when he indicated he hadn’t even lobbied Mr Shorten to make any firm commitment.
“It is quite clear that Mr Weatherill is very intent on playing political games over this issue.
“If Premier Weatherill has this opinion of his own Federal Labor Leader, it’s no wonder he can’t work with the Prime Minister of the day to deliver a better deal for South Australia.”
